About ThedaCare:

ThedaCare is a community health system consisting of seven hospitals, numerous clinics and related services. We are the third largest health care employer in Wisconsin and the largest employer in the state's second largest economic market - Northeast Wisconsin - with approximately 6,800 employees. Through our 100-year history, ThedaCare has woven itself into the very fabric of the communities we serve. For our employees, ThedaCare offers an environment that not only welcomes but also encourages innovative thinking and fresh approaches to today’s health care challenges.

We’ve improved the health of thousands of individuals. We know this because we track our quality and constantly seek to improve our care and services for the members of our communities.

The Regional Development Officer – Annual Giving is responsible for developing and coordinating the foundation’s annual giving efforts, including: grateful patient programs, direct mail campaigns, employee giving programs, and physician engagement strategies. The role works with internal and external partners to identify and share impact stories, acquire new donors, provide stewardship to existing donors and build a funnel of major gift prospects.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  • Work to increase participation in annual giving by building and implementing comprehensive, data driven strategies to move donors to higher giving levels. 
  • Craft positive impact stories and coordinate the development of effective stewardship and solicitation marketing pieces and case statements to ensure thoughtful and consistent communication with the foundation’s donors. 
  • Serve as the assigned solicitor to a prospect portfolio with annual goals for personal visits and giving outcomes to move those donors through the donor cycle. 
  • Serve as the staff lead for the employee giving program, resulting in increased awareness, participation and engagement from employees throughout ThedaCare. 
  • Oversee the Foundation’s grateful patient program to ensure patients are informed about the foundation and new, appropriate prospects are invited to give.
